Introduction
Umbraco CMS is renowned for its flexibility and developer-friendly architecture. While many guides cover the basics and key features, this article delves into advanced customization techniques that allow web developers to harness the full potential of Umbraco for feature-rich and unique web projects.

Understanding Umbraco’s Extensibility
Umbraco offers a highly extensible platform, making it possible to tailor nearly every aspect of the CMS to fit your needs. From creating custom data types to extending core functionalities with plugins and integrations, Umbraco provides the tools needed for complex content management scenarios.

Custom Data Types and Property Editors
One of the most powerful features in Umbraco is the ability to define custom data types and property editors. This allows developers to provide content editors with tailored input interfaces:

  • Custom Property Editors: Build property editors in AngularJS, React, or plain JavaScript to capture specialized input beyond the built-in options.
  • Data Type Configuration: Set up reusable data structures for consistent data entry and display.

Implementing Custom Controllers and APIs
Umbraco supports the addition of custom ASP.NET controllers and Web APIs. This enables developers to:

  • Serve dynamic content based on user interaction.
  • Integrate with third-party systems and services.
  • Expose JSON or XML endpoints for Single Page Applications (SPAs) or headless CMS scenarios.

By leveraging Umbraco’s routing and SurfaceController, you can create custom logic for both the back office and front-end applications.

Theming and Custom Layouts
Umbraco uses a component-based approach to theming with views, partial views, and macros. Advanced developers can:

  • Utilize Razor templates for complex layout logic.
  • Add macros to inject reusable dynamic components.
  • Integrate third-party frontend frameworks for a modern user experience.

Working with User Permissions and Workflow
For enterprise projects, Umbraco’s customizable user roles and permissions ensure secure content management. Additionally, workflows can be implemented to handle content approval, publishing stages, and notifications to relevant stakeholders.

Integrating with External Systems
Umbraco can be connected to CRMs, e-commerce platforms, marketing automation tools, and other web services. Developers can use event handlers and scheduled tasks to process data synchronization automatically, making Umbraco a central hub for digital operations.
